Building the Growth of Chinese Children's Literature on Translation

Abstract
This paper,from the perspective of translated children's literature in China chiefly during the last three decades,reviews the development of Chinese children's literature,particularly the hardships and obstacles it has undergone and overcome since 1949,arguing that it is a necessary and inevitable outcome that Chinese children's literature has joined the world in this respect by means of consciously sharing the universal values in the latter.This paper is dedicated to the commemoration of China's 30th anniversary of reform and opening to the outside world.
